The Massachusetts Noise Ordinance refers to the set of regulations imposed by local governing bodies to control and manage excessive noise levels within the state. These ordinances aim to maintain a peaceful and harmonious environment for residents, protect public health, and prevent disturbances to daily life activities. Massachusetts law outlines specific guidelines and restrictions to address various sources of noise pollution. The first type of Massachusetts Noise Ordinance pertains to general noise regulations applicable to all residents and businesses. It limits the duration and intensity of noise generated from construction sites, vehicles, machinery, musical instruments, audio systems, and other activities. This ordinance typically prohibits loud and unreasonable noises that disrupt the peace and quiet of neighborhoods, particularly during nighttime hours or near residential zones. Another type of noise ordinance in Massachusetts focuses on regulating specific noise sources prevalent in urban areas. This includes regulations related to bars, nightclubs, restaurants, and other entertainment venues. These establishments are required to adhere to specific soundproofing measures, noise emission limits, and restricted operating hours to prevent disturbances to nearby residential areas. Furthermore, Massachusetts Noise Ordinances offer guidelines for managing noise generated by public events and festivals. Event organizers must obtain permits and comply with noise level limitations to ensure that the event does not create excessive noise pollution, affecting nearby communities and their quality of life. It is worth noting that each municipality in Massachusetts may have its own variation of the Noise Ordinance, tailored to address local needs and concerns. These ordinances could include additional restrictions and rules relevant to the specific locale. An unreasonable level of noise is: anything louder than 50 decibels from 11 p.m. to 7 a.m., or. anything louder than 70 decibels at any time, except for permitted construction.

(1) Daytime threshold: During daytime hours, no person or persons owning, leasing or controlling the operations of any source or sources of noise shall willfully, negligently or through failure to provide necessary muffler equipment or facilities or through failure to take necessary precautions make or permit any ...

If the noise level at a sensitive receptor's location is more than 10 dB(A) above ambient, MassDEP requires the noise source to mitigate its impact.

Contact your local Board of Health for noise disturbances from business operations and activities, from campgrounds and other outdoor venues and from heavy equipment such as heating and ventilation systems, air conditioners, other rooftop machinery, wind turbines and construction.
